Capital Projects

Annual construction projects are identified through a 10-year forecast process. The capital projects schedule below identifies current or proposed projects and estimated timelines for commencing projects.

Capital Projects Scheduled for 2022

The planned Public Works capital projects for 2022 are listed below. Please note that schedules are subject to change.

Ongoing Projects
County Rd 1 Rehabilitation of the Drag River Bridge
Drag River Bridge rehabilitation is on-going open to one lane of traffic using temporary traffic lights.  Expect delays due to lane restrictions. Please follow traffic control. Completion date fall 2022.
County Rd 1 Hot Mix Paving (Geeza Rd 4.5 kms to southern limit of Gelert Village)
Resurfacing process is continuing.  Loose gravel sections are expected.  Be prepared for delays.  Nearing completion.
 County Rd 8 Surface Treatment (Camp Dorset Rd 4.1 kms to McComb Point Dr)
Surface Treatment is now complete.  Loose gravel sections can be expected.  Awaiting pavement markings. 
County Rd 10 Rehabilitation of the York River Bridge
York River bridge rehabilitation is on-going open to one lane of traffic using temporary traffic lights.  Expect delays due to lane restrictions. Please follow traffic control. Completion date fall 2022.
County Rd 11 Surface Treatment (Hwy 118 5.9 kms to Oliver Rd)
Surface Treatment has been completed.  Loose gravel sections are expected.  Awaiting pavement markings. 
County Rd 11 Surface Treatment (2192 Kushog Lake Rd 6.8 kms to Hwy 35)
Surface Treatment has been completed.  Loose gravel sections are expected.  Awaiting pavement markings.  
County Rd 15 Surface Treatment (Yankton Lk 2.6 kms to 1km S of Kennaway Lk)
Surface Treatment is now complete.  Loose gravel sections can be expected.  Awaiting pavement markings. 
 County Rd 16 Hot Mix Paving (Hwy 35 3.5 kms to 0.8 km E of Bat Lake Rd)
Resurfacing process has begun.  Loose gravel sections are expected.  Be prepared for delays. 
County Rd 18 Surface Treatment (Tom Bolton Rd 3.7 kms to Williams Landing)
Surface Treatment has been completed.  Loose gravel sections are expected.  Awaiting pavement markings. 
County Rd 19 Surface Treatment (Pluto Trail 2.5 kms to Indian Point Rd)
Surface Treatment is now complete.  Loose gravel sections can be expected.  Awaiting pavement markings. 
County Rd 648 Rehabilitation of the Dark Lake Bridge
Dark Lake bridge rehabilitation is on-going open to one lane of traffic using temporary traffic lights.  Expect delays due to lane restrictions.  Please follow traffic control.  Completion date fall 2022.

 

 Upcoming Projects
 
 County Rd 648 Rehabilitation of the Lower Cup Lake Culvert
 Anticipated start the week of July 25 with temporary traffic control as required
 2022 Completed Projects
 
 County Rd 1 Culvert Replacement
 Culvert replacement work has been completed in preparation for paving. Loose gravel sections can be  expected.  
County Rd 11 Replacement of 11 Culverts (Hwy 118 to Hwy 35)
Culvert replacement work has been completed in preparation for paving. Loose gravel sections can be  expected.  
County Rd 16 Replacement of 7 Culverts (Hwy 35 to Bat Lake Rd)
Culvert replacement work has been completed in preparation for paving. Loose gravel sections can be  expected.
